Output 8a89caec337fa59191f3abc68f4384ec2df95fcdb8d6fc3c993d38436dcac4c9:27

value
108268
script pubkey
OP_0 OP_PUSHBYTES_20 f2ae0f9c79f76c717cf2d577e4e748d858b541d0
address
bc1q72hql8re7ak8zl8j64m7fe6gmpvt2sws7jdyuf
transaction
8a89caec337fa59191f3abc68f4384ec2df95fcdb8d6fc3c993d38436dcac4c9
confirmations
158101
spent
true